Understanding the Mechanics of the Aviator Game
At its heart, the aviator game operates on a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This means that the outcome of each round is determined by a complex algorithm, ensuring transparency and eliminating any possibility of manipulation by the game provider. The RNG generates a multiplier, which increases exponentially as the airplane ascends on the screen. Players set their initial bet before each round begins, and the objective is to cash out before the plane flies out of view. The multiplier at the moment of cash out determines the payout, calculated as the initial bet multiplied by the multiplier. It's crucial to understand that there's no guaranteed winning strategy; the game relies heavily on chance and timing. However, understanding probability and risk management can significantly improve your chances of success.
The Role of the Random Number Generator
The provably fair RNG is the backbone of trust in any online game of chance, and the aviator game is no exception. Unlike traditional RNGs, where the algorithm is kept secret, provably fair systems allow players to verify the fairness of each round independently. This is typically achieved through cryptographic hashing and seeding, enabling players to confirm that the outcome wasn't predetermined. This level of transparency provides peace of mind and builds confidence in the integrity of the game. Players can often access tools or information on the platform to verify the fairness of past rounds, furthering the sense of security. This process is vital for maintaining a healthy and trustworthy gaming environment, fostering a long-term player base.
The core concept centers around a server seed, a value generated by the game provider, and a client seed, which can be influenced or chosen by the player. These seeds are combined and used to generate the outcome of the round. By publicly revealing the server seed and allowing players to verify it against their client seed, the game establishes its commitment to fairness. This innovative approach represents a significant step forward in online gaming transparency and helps to dispel any lingering concerns about rigged outcomes.

Strategies for Playing the Aviator Game
While luck plays a significant role, several strategies can be employed to enhance your gameplay and potentially increase your winning odds. One common approach is the ‘low and steady’ method, where players aim to cash out at relatively low multipliers (e.g., 1.2x to 1.5x). This strategy offers a higher probability of winning, although the payouts are smaller. Another popular tactic is the ‘Martingale system,’ which invol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the goal of recouping your losses and earning a small profit when you eventually win. However, the Martingale system requires a substantial bankroll and carries a significant risk of depletion. It is important to remember that no strategy guarantees success, and responsible gambling is paramount.

Psychological Aspects of the Aviator Game
The aviator game isn't just about mathematical probabilities; it’s also deeply rooted in psychology. The thrill of watching the plane ascend, coupled with the fear of it flying away, creates a unique emotional rollercoaster. This adrenaline rush can lead to impulsive decisions, such as waiting too long for a higher multiplier and ultimately losing your bet. Understanding your own psychological biases is crucial for maintaining composure and making rational choices. The “near miss” effect, where the plane crashes just after you’ve cashed out, can be particularly frustrating and tempting to chase after a win. However, it's important to remember that each round is independent, and past outcomes have no bearing on future results.
